La azoospermia es una alteración en la que se observa una ausencia de espermatozoides en el eyaculado, a parte de este hecho no existe ningún otro síntoma. Ni dolor que ayude a sospechar la presencia de esta enfermedad. Para diagnosticar azoospermia, según las recomendaciones de la OMS es necesaria la realización de dos seminogramas con al menos dos meses de intervalo que confirmen los resultados. There are three major causes. Of azoospermia: hormonal, the testis are not properly stimulated; production problems in the testis or complications in the carriage of of sperm from the testicles to the urethra. Azoospermia, in this case, is originated by altered hormone levels. Especially the FSH (follicle stimulant hormone), responsible of stimulating the testicle so that it can produce sperm. Obstructive azoospermia (AO) is less serious. Than the secretory type and does not produce as many problems to conceive. The absence of spermatozoa in the ejaculate is due to problems in the efferent ducts. Or epididymis, however, the testicles are able to produce sperm. In order to find sperm, it is necessary to retrieve them from the obstructed duct by aspiration. Obstructive azoospermia surgical intervention.
